SOURCE: replace blower motor 1998 plymouth voyager

it is located behind and below the glove box,you might want to remove the glove box assembly to see it easier,
there are four screws holding a blower motor cover you to take off first,now remove the screws holding the blower motor up,disconnect the motor wires.
if your changing this because you think its bad,you should test the blower motor wires with a test light with the key on and blower switch turned on.if you have power in the wires,then it is bad.
but if you have no power in wires it could be blower motor resister,or switch.

94 Plymouth voyager where is blower motor relay located

I believe you are looking for the blower motor resistor pack. Usually located on passenger front under dash/glove compartment area. The are normally held in with a couple of screws, screwed onto the HVAC unit itself.

Front blower motor doesn't work, rear does

check or replace your front blower motor resistor. this is the most common problem aside from a bad blower switch. you could also try to recalibrate your system but that usually doesn't work. I'm betting on the resistor.
